OREANDA-NEWS Russian theaters located in nine foreign countries plan to stage 30 performances in 2024 with the support of the Ministry of Culture of Russia, the head of the Ministry Olga Lyubimova told President Vladimir Putin.

"On your instructions, we have started supporting Russian theaters abroad. Russian Russian theaters in 43 countries of the world play Russian classics in Russian. We choose productions together. We have the anniversary year of Alexander Sergeevich Pushkin ahead of us, this year is the 200th anniversary of Alexander Nikolaevich Ostrovsky, so we choose the material together. They choose what is closer, more interesting to put. This year, 15 performances have already appeared in eight countries, in nine countries we are planning 30 performances in 2024 and further incrementally," the minister said.

The Ministry of Culture supports, among other things, Russian theaters in Abkhazia, Belarus, Kyrgyzstan, Tajikistan, Turkmenistan, Uzbekistan, and South Ossetia.
